Breakfast Pan Pizza

I love pizza in the mornings, especially for brunch. You can add whatever you fancy, but the EGGS are a must.

Ingredients

  • For the Dough:
  • 1 cup water, lukewarm
  • 1 tablespoon honey
  • 1 tablespoon dry yeast
  • 4 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 1/2 cups flour
  • For the Filling:
  • 1 cup grated cheese
  • 3 scallions, sliced
  • 4 eggs
  • 1/2 cup cooked crumbled bacon
  • 12 cherry tomatoes, halved

Details

Servings 4

Preparation

Step 1



Makes 4 portions

In a bowl, mix water, honey and yeast. Leave it for 5 minutes so that the yeast starts to work.

Add flour, salt, and oil. Work the dough together. Cover with plastic and let it rise for 1 hour. Preheat oven to 400°F. Divide the dough into 4 pieces. Press dough into 4 oiled pans.

Add cheese and half the scallions. Bake for about 5 minutes, take them out and crack an egg in the middle of each pizza. Bake again, until the egg is set. This will take around 6-7 minutes. Once done, add bacon, the rest of the scallions, and tomatoes.

Water that is too hot could kill the yeast, so make sure your water is lukewarm.
